A 47-year-old man admitted to sexually assaulting a woman during a 2024 home invasion in the middle of his trial yesterday.
Mike Dwayne Rahming pleaded guilty to charges of rape and burglary just days after his trial began before Justice Loren Klein.
During the trial, the court heard a recording of the defendant apologising to the victim for the rape and burglary during a confrontation. He also asked the woman to forgive him.
Rahming broke into the woman's residence and raped her on October 20, 2024.
Following his guilty plea, he was remanded to the Bahamas Department of Correctional Services until he returns to court for sentencing later this year.
Janessa Murray and Terneille Bain prosecuted the case.
Nathan Bain represented the accused.
